A patient has absconded during an escorted outing from a secure hospital.

Paul Brownlie, a restricted patient at the Rohallion Secure Care Clinic in Perth, went missing from the outing in the city on Wednesday.

The 33-year-old is white, about 5ft 10ins with a stocky build. He has blue eyes, short fair hair and was wearing a navy jacket, white t-shirt, blue jeans and white trainers.

He is believed to be in the Edinburgh area.

Authorities said they are keen to trace him as soon as possible and anyone with information has been asked to contact police.

A Scottish Government statement said: "Although he is not considered to be a high risk of harm, the public are advised not to approach him.

"If anyone sees him, or has any information regarding his whereabouts, they should contact Police Scotland on 101."
